For years, Mistral has been the smaller, less-funded rival in a race it seemed to be losing. The Paris-based lab never had OpenAI's budget or Anthropic's safety cachet. But a string of events in 2025 has reshuffled the deck in ways that money alone cannot fix.
What actually changed this year?
Two things happened in quick succession, and together they made Mistral's pitch suddenly land.
First, the Trump administration imposed restrictions in June 2025 on how AI models from Anthropic and OpenAI can be distributed outside the United States. For European governments already uneasy about depending on American technology, this was a warning shot. If Washington can restrict access to cutting-edge AI once, it can do it again.
Second, an OpenAI model escaped its testing sandbox, a controlled environment where AI is evaluated before release, and compromised systems at multiple companies. Anthropic then disclosed that its own models had shown similar behaviour. Both companies use closed-weight models: AI systems whose internal workings are kept secret by the developer. Critics argue that secrecy makes independent safety checks nearly impossible.
Mistral's models are mostly published under open-source licences. Anyone can download them, inspect them, run them on their own computers, and build products on top of them. That openness is now a selling point, not just a philosophical stance.
"If you don't end up in a situation where most people are building open source, you're giving way too much power to companies that are going to become state-like," Mistral CEO Arthur Mensch said at a Paris AI conference last month, speaking to a packed room.
What does this mean for businesses outside the US?
For a European hospital, bank, or government ministry, the practical concern is continuity. A closed American AI service can be repriced, restricted, or switched off by executive order. An open-weight model running on local servers cannot.
That argument is winning contracts. Mistral's revenue grew roughly twenty-fold in the past year, according to Wired, with deals spanning the French government, Microsoft, HSBC, and others. The lab has also built a consulting arm whose engineers embed directly inside client organisations, a model borrowed from data-analytics firm Palantir.
Andrea Renda, director of research at the Centre for European Policy Studies, put it plainly: European sovereignty goals plus American political hostility amount to "a magic formula" for Mistral, even though the lab's raw model performance has not been spectacular.

What is an open-weight AI model, and why does it matter?
An open-weight model is an AI system whose internal numerical settings, the "weights" that determine how it thinks, are published publicly. Anyone can download it, audit it, or run it without asking the original developer's permission.
Does this mean US AI companies are losing?
Not yet, and not necessarily. OpenAI and Anthropic still build the most capable models available. The shift is in who controls the infrastructure: more organisations are choosing to run AI on their own servers using open models rather than relying entirely on American cloud services.
How does distillation change the competitive picture?
Distillation is a technique where a smaller, cheaper AI model is trained by imitating the outputs of a larger, more capable one. It steadily narrows the performance gap between closed proprietary models and open alternatives, eroding the premium that US labs charge for exclusivity.
